TDS Limits for Professional Services Under Section 194J

The Income Tax Act imposes TDS on professional and technical services under Section 194J. Companies (except individuals and Hindu undivided families) are required to deduct tax when making payments for certain specific services to residents. Tax Deducted at Source – Sterlingtax Partners LLP

Tax Deducted at Source (TDS) is a procedure implemented by the Indian government to collect taxes at the source of income. A certain percentage of tax is deducted by the payer at the time of making payments to the receiver, and this amount is then remitted to the government.
